titleOfInvention Hybrid stent apparatus
abstract A medical device ( 10 ) for use in passageways of the human or animal body comprises a catheter ( 30 ) having an expandable arrangement ( 38 ), such as a balloon arrangement, located at the distal portion of the catheter, and capable of deploying a stent apparatus ( 20 ) mounted at the distal portion of the catheter ( 30 ). The stent apparatus ( 20 ) is a hybrid stent apparatus having a central part ( 21 ) that is self-expanding, and end parts ( 22, 23 ) that are expandable by the balloon arrangement.
